Select Brand:

Show All


£37.00

Dispatch on next business day

£35.68

Dispatch on next business day

£5.94

Dispatch on next business day

£12.87

Dispatch on next business day

£16.83

Dispatch on next business day

£10.83

Dispatch on next business day

£12.28

Dispatch on next business day

£2.82

Dispatch on next business day

£12.87

Dispatch on next business day

£25.12

Dispatch on next business day

£31.38

Dispatch on next business day

£36.12

Dispatch on next business day